Notes
*-with Pete Sears; +-with Bruce Hornsby
(Furthur Festival)
(1) Bob, Bruce, Mint Juleps, Debbie Henry, Los Lobo's bass and sax players,
Jorma, both of Hornsby's horn players, Mickey Hart and two of his
drummers.
(2) Same as above, minus the Mint Juleps and Debbie Henry. I can't recall
who else wandered onto stage at this point. I believe David Hidalgo
and another drummer joined them.
(3) Lead guitarist from Los Lobos leaves with Bruce Hornsby and the horn
players; Cesar Rosas from Los Lobos steps in on lead
guitar. (As much as anyone can play lead guitar with Jorma on the
same stage, that is!) Otherwise, same as above.
(4) Bob, Bruce on keys, Pete Sears on accordian, Michael Falzarano from Hot Tuna
on mandolin, Jorma, and the usual suspects.
